What is the 15 Acre Homestead?
The 15 Acre Homestead is a working farm dedicated to teaching individuals about sustainable living and homesteading. The homestead spans fifteen acres of lush, productive land, featuring gardens, livestock, and various renewable energy systems. It serves as an educational hub for those seeking to learn about self-sufficiency and sustainability.

Gardening and Food Production
Gardening is a cornerstone of homesteading, and the 15 Acre Homestead offers extensive education in this area. Participants will learn about crop rotation, companion planting, and natural pest control methods. The homestead’s gardens are a testament to the effectiveness of these techniques, providing fresh, organic produce throughout the growing season.
Animal Husbandry
Raising animals is an integral part of homesteading, and the 15 Acre Homestead offers instruction in animal husbandry. Participants will learn how to care for chickens, goats, and bees, gaining insight into the benefits of livestock on a homestead.
Renewable Energy
The 15 Acre Homestead is equipped with various renewable energy systems, including solar panels and wind turbines. Participants will learn how these systems work and how they can be integrated into a homestead to reduce reliance on fossil fuels.
